SeaTac grew up around the airport, and its housing reflects that mix, older single-family homes, a large share of rental and multi-family housing, and commercial frontage strung along International Boulevard near Angle Lake. That variety is what defines the plumbing here.
Only about four miles from Renton, SeaTac sits on the same wet-mild ground with the same low freeze risk, so the residential concerns are familiar. What stands out is the volume of rental and higher-traffic housing, which wears fixtures harder than an owner-occupied home.
Rentals, older homes and commercial frontage
Rental and multi-family housing sees more use and more turnover than owner-occupied homes, so fixtures, water heaters and drains wear faster and fail more often. Landlords and managers here tend to need responsive repair and the kind of water heater replacement that keeps a unit rentable.
The older single-family homes bring the standard concerns of established housing, aging supply, crawl space leaks and root-prone side sewers, while the commercial strip along International Boulevard adds premises where a plumbing failure means lost trade, not just inconvenience.

What SeaTac calls about
The rental housing drives a lot of the work, quick fixture and drain repairs, and water heater installation and replacement done promptly to keep a unit in service. High-use fixtures fail more often, so the calls are frequent but usually straightforward.
Older homes add the leak and sewer work common across the area, and when a drain keeps backing up, drain cleaning clears the immediate problem while a camera settles whether the side sewer is the real cause. Being close to Renton keeps response fast.
A mixed city around the airport
SeaTac takes its name and much of its character from the airport at its heart, and it blends commercial and hospitality property with established residential neighborhoods. That mix means two kinds of work sit side by side: homes with the usual older-housing questions of aging supply and root-prone side sewers, and commercial premises whose high-use fixtures, backflow protection and grease-laden kitchen drains ask for a different rhythm of maintenance and the jetting a cable cannot match.
